I just purchased a 1999 60hp yamaha outboard. The previous owner only had a fuel gauge installed. It is not functioning and I'd like to purchase the following gauges and install them:


  • Fuel

  • Temperature

  • RPM

  • Tilt/Trim

The fuel gauge I can figure out, since it's already installed. But where do I go to figure out what will be needed for the others?

Re: Need help with gauges and installation

I think you can get most of those from Yamaha. If so they will be plug and play with the Yamaha harness. I have a 50 4-stroke and have Yamaha gauge, though the RPM and oil (idiot light),are one gauge, trim is seperate. Fuel is also seperate but matches. No temp sender on my motor.
